HELP NEEDED TO DO PAINTING THIS APRIL /MAY!
THIS YEAR 2022
We will be painting and finishing the inside of the round house. As always there is some carpentry jobs to be done too.
We are Mick 42 carpenter from Ireland, Marja 35 from Finland and our two kids Leo 7 and Luna 4 years(5 in July). We live in the countryside in North Karelia 20 km from Joensuu city center. We are building a debt free, natural, straw bale insulated roundhouse to have a debt free life in. We bought in December 2016 five hectares of forest land adjoining a lake and the fields of Marja's Dads organic vegetable farm.
We want to live a simple life in the countryside, close to nature and growing most of our own food. In season we pick lots of mushrooms and berries for preserving.
You will be sharing our rented farm house which is a 500 meter walk through the forest to the building site.
We are expecting the main house project to last 4 years, in 2017 we did the planning, made a road, prepared all the logs, cleared the site, did ground works, foundations and started the timber floor of the house. In 2018 we got the roundwood timber framed walls and roof structure up, and started covering the roof. In 2019 we finished the roof covering and built the straw bale walls. In 2020 we got the walls coated in clay plaster, fit the windows, insulated the floor and roof. In 2021 we finished plastering the upper ceiling, built an adobe clay brick wall with glass bottles. 2022 building the floor, building a kitchen, making a stairs, some finishing on the outside of the house and some painting too.

We are looking for people with a keen interest in crafts/hand work or an interest in gathering berries in season and harvesting and processing vegetables.
The tasks will be varied over the length of the project, but will include peeling trees for building wood, general carpentry, roofing, straw bale erecting, clay plastering, general site help such as digging and moving earth, preparing the garden and many other things.
We have learned from the last years that the longer people stay the better it works out for all involved, and are hoping to have people for a minimum of one month or longer.
we are looking for helpers for a few different kind of jobs, here we try to describe them as well as possible so that you know what to expect. Please read the descriptions well and tell us what job are you wanting to do:
Help 1: minimum stay 1 month
This person will be helping Mick on the house. Whenever Mick needs someone with him on the house you would be helping out doing some carpentry type projects, clay plastering, painting. The other time you would be getting building materials ready, tidying up the area etc. You should have some experience of using hand tools and not be afraid of heights (3-5 meters).
Help 2; shorter stays are OK.
An experienced builder.
Help 3: Longer stay 5 or 6 months.
Someone with a keen interest in building could work with me on the house and I will teach everything I can about our building techniques, using roundwood, clay plastering, strawbale building etc. but probably mostly we end up doing carpentry work. We have already had a helper stay for 6 months in 2018 and it worked out really great for us all, lots of learning about life and ourselves.

We have two bedrooms available in our traditional Finnish farm house. We eat only vegan food. We have all food together, simple, local wholesome mostly organic food.
For the Summer camping is another option.Algo más...
Free time: we live by two lakes to swim in, we can give you bicycles to go for a cycle and you can cycle to Joensuu 20km, there is a restaurant in the local village! You can do berry and mushroom picking later in the summer, walks in the woods, we have regular sauna.
